2 possibilities :Rylos wrote:Was this taken out on purpose? if so what would I select in its place?
- ADFOpus with HFE support :
https://hxc2001.com/download/floppy_driv ... us_HxC.zip
OR
<<
- create a "myfloppy.amigados" folder the pc.
- drag & drop it on the hxc application
- export the image (hfe format).
>>

Re: HxCFloppyEmulator v2.0.18.4 missing Amiga file system ty
Atari ST = DOS file system.
If someone want to add the AmigaDos support all the sources are there :
http://sourceforge.net/p/hxcfloppyemu/c ... yEmulator/
ADFlib is already into the hxc library so this should not be too hard.
